1039. To ask the Minister for Health if he will expedite a medical card appeal in respect of persons(details supplied) in County Kerry who were issued with general practitioner visit cards only and are on long term medication; if he will issue discretionary medical cards in this case; and if he will make a statement on the matter. The Health Service Executive has been asked to examine this matter and to reply to the Deputy as soon as possible. The Health Service Executive operates the General Medical Services scheme, which includes medical cards and GP visit cards, under the Health Act 1970, as amended. It has established a dedicated contact service for members of the Oireachtas specifically for queries relating to medical cards and GP visit cards, which the Deputy may wish to use for an earlier response. Contact information has recently reissued to Oireachtas members.
